Recently there have been a lot of flaky actions caused by GitHub failing to
download tarball. Switch to tagged releases as they have pre-generated
tarballs so hopefully are less prone to issues.

This series collects all upstream developments of pin-init to date and
synchronize them to the kernel tree.

A major change in this cycle is the bump of MSRV to 1.82 to get rid of
unstable features, following the kernel version bump in 7.1. The MSRV is
bumped straight to 1.85 as pin-init can also be used outside kernel, so we
avoid bumping unless there is a need for new version.

Here are the list of merged changes included in the series:

- examples: mark as `#[inline]` all `From::from()`s for `Error`
  Rust-for-Linux/pin-init#126
- bump minimum Rust version to 1.82
  Rust-for-Linux/pin-init#129
- cleanup `Zeroable` and `ZeroableOptions`
  Rust-for-Linux/pin-init#118
- internal: add missing where clause to projection types
  Rust-for-Linux/pin-init#121
- internal: internal: remove redundant `#[pin]` filtering
  Rust-for-Linux/pin-init#131

For information, here are the list of upstream-only changes, which are
related to Cargo or tests/CI changes only.

- build.rs: use `option_env!` to register env variable dependency
  Rust-for-Linux/pin-init#128
- clean up dependencies
  Rust-for-Linux/pin-init#130
- tests: add test for check correct macro hygiene 
  Rust-for-Linux/pin-init#133
- ci: use tagged release of actions
  Rust-for-Linux/pin-init#134
- ci: have a single job to gate all required jobs
  Rust-for-Linux/pin-init#138
